GENERAL DESCRIPTION  
The AD8353 is a broadband, fixed-gain, linear amplifier that  
operates at frequencies from 1 MHz up to 2.7 GHz. It is  
intended for use in a wide variety of wireless devices, including  
cellular, broadband, CATV, and LMDS/MMDS applications.  
The noise figure is 5.3 dB at 900 MHz. The reverse isolation  
(S12) is −36 dB at 900 MHz and −30 dB at 2.7 GHz.  
The AD8353 can also operate with a 5 V power supply; in  
which case, no external inductor is required. Under these  
conditions, the AD8353 delivers 8 dBm with 20 dB of gain at  
900 MHz. The dc supply current is 42 mA. At 900 MHz, the  
OIP3 is greater than 22 dBm and is 19 dBm at 2.7 GHz. The noise  
figure is 5.6 dB at 900 MHz. The reverse isolation (S12) is −35 dB.  
By taking advantage of Analog Devices, Inc., high performance,  
complementary Si bipolar process, these gain blocks provide  
excellent stability over process, temperature, and power supply.  
This amplifier is single-ended and internally matched to 50 Ω  
with a return loss of greater than 10 dB over the full operating  
frequency range.  
The AD8353 is fabricated on Analog Devices proprietary, high  
performance, 25 GHz, Si complementary, bipolar IC process.  
The AD8353 is available in a chip scale package that uses an  
exposed paddle for excellent thermal impedance and low  
impedance electrical connection to ground. It operates over a  
−40°C to +85°C temperature range, and an evaluation board is  
also available.  
The AD8353 provides linear output power of 9 dBm with 20 dB  
of gain at 900 MHz when biased at 3 V and an external RF  
choke is connected between the power supply and the output  
pin. The dc supply current is 42 mA. At 900 MHz, the output  
third-order intercept (OIP3) is greater than 23 dBm and is  
19 dBm at 2.7 GHz.
